Bay Path Defeats Elms and Clinches a Berth in NECC Championships
LONGMEADOW, Mass. - Freshman forward Stephanie
Belsen (Windsor Locks, Conn.) nets the lone goal of
the game to propel the Wildcats to earn their first ever New
England Conference Championship berth. Bay Path defeated the
Elms College Blazers 1-0 in NECC field hockey action today at Ryan
Field.
Both programs were able to hold off any scoring in the first half
with Bay Path having seven shots in the first 35 minutes. In the
49th minute of play, senior forward Jessica
Priestly (Middleboro, Mass.) managed a well played
pass inside to Belsen to score the eventual game winner for the
Wildcats.
Bay Path finished with 10 shots eight of which were on goal and seven penalty corners. Elms' offense was unable to get the ball past the back line for any shots in the 70 minutes of play.
Sophomore goalkeeper Alexandra Bonavita (Agawam, Mass.) tallied seven saves while suffering the loss, while senior goalie Kim Barbato (Saylorsburg, Penn.) recorded the shut-out for Bay Path.
Bay Path is now 3-8 overall and 2-5 in the NECC, while Elms falls to 0-16 on the season and finishes 0-8 in conference play.
